Ever since the forced password change, I can't get chrome to remember my log in credentials, no matter what I do. I tried ever little "remember me" check box I could find. Every time I close the browser, and I return to satelliteguys, I have to log in. I'm going nuts here. :confused:
 
I had that problem too in FireFox. I had to remove all the satelliteguys cookies and that fixed it.
 
Well you didn't have to, but it sure was a good idea. I changed mine immediately. Deleting SatelliteGuys cookies fixed the login bug.

I am having to log in each visit ever since the password hassle. I am using Fire Fox and don't see where Sat Guys cookies can be deleted. What would the path to this be?

Tools>Options>Privacy then select "Remove Individual Cookies". It still didn't work until I clicked in the "Remember Me" box.

Thanks for the reply, I found the cookie for sat guys and deleted it, but still have to log in each time.

there's more than one cookie. remove all that say satguys, satelliteguys etc....
 
There were a lot more than just one when I deleted mine.
